From c2009a4c90853a08129783a36b5d8d5dd8fcdfed Mon Sep 17 00:00:00 2001 From: "George V. Neville-Neil" Date: Fri, 22 May 2009 15:06:03 +0000 Subject: [PATCH] Fix a possible panic cxgb_controller_attach() routine that would occur only if prepping the adapter failed. Slight adjustment to comments. Fix a bug whereby downing the interface didn't preven it from processing packets.
